Fundamentals and New Directions in Plasma Medicine: Roles of Reactive Species

摘要

Reactive chemical species, including reactive oxygen and reactive nitrogen, are key to understanding the mechanisms by which plasmas act to modify biological systems. There is no doubt that plasmas operating in air at atmospheric pressure create bioactive species. These species are known to be important in normal physiological processes like signaling, but are also associated with many important diseases. Intriguingly, recent research has revealed that some therapies utilize these species, suggesting that plasmas may be effective for similar reasons. The challenges of utilizing plasmas for biomedical applications include controlling the distribution of reactive species created and controlling the reaction pathways and transport of reactive species products, especially lipids and proteins, to the places and at the concentrations that are needed to be most beneficial and least damaging.
